Discover LudwigThe phrase "account applies"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ts where you are indicating that a particular account or set of rules is relevant or applicable to a situation.
Example: "In this case, the standard account applies, and all participants must adhere to the guidelines provided."
Alternatives: "account is relevant" or "account is applicable".
